Wilson and Aisbett strong in Samoa Open

01 July 2017, 12:00AM

The second day of the Invest Samoa Open and Senior Open yesterday saw both leaders from Day one consolidate with subpar second rounds.

Peter Wilson, the Samoa Open Defending Champion, although having the most difficult of the conditions due to late rain hitting the Faleata Golf Course carded a solid 68 which included five birdies and only one bogey.

Wilson sits on a two round total of 11 under 133 three shots clear of Pieter Zwart of NZ who had rounds of 67 and 69.

Stephen Aisbett from New South Wales Australia had six birdies and two bogies in his second round 68 to lead the Invest Samoa Senior Open on 135 nine under par.

Hot on his heels and joining him in the last group of Legends today are Brad Burns from Queensland and three time champion Richard Backwell who are one and two shots behind respectively.

Play starts today from 7.30am with the leaders in the Taula National Championships hitting off ahead of the Professionals who will start at 8.40am with the leaders teeing off at 10.30am.
